Set along University Avenue, this spot buzzes with neighborhood energy and the smell of baking dough from the oven. Servers are often praised by name, and a guest called the vibe warm and inviting. On busy nights it can swing from lively to downright loud, but the bar view of the oven and a patio add charm to the cozy, casual room. Many regulars return for comfort dishes and friendly touches from hands-on ownership. The kitchen leans Southern Italian: airy pinsa with balanced toppings, crisp and tender chicken parm, and a lasagna that fans rave about. Execution aims for elevated traditional cooking rather than showy fusion, with attention to quality ingredients over tricks. Portions are satisfying, and while prices run a bit above casual, many diners feel the food earns it. A few plates can skew inconsistent on hectic nights, but when it hits, it is deeply comforting. Families do well here. Kids gravitate to cheese pizza and straightforward pastas, and several parents noted kind service with little ones. The menu has plenty a child will recognize, from margherita to spaghetti and chicken parm. Note that substitutions are limited and some drinks lack refills, so set expectations; otherwise, this is a solid pick for family dinner in Hillcrest.
